Ah, there was your problem. I've been reading almost everyone that ran the H3C kit, the bulbs popped. Anybody running a full H3 kit?
 
from what i understand, its from the design of the H3C bulb. while they are close to the actual H3 halogen bulbs, they were initially designed for use in scuba gear, to be operated on 25w power, not 35w. so, basically, running them in an automotive environment, you are over powering them, which leads to premature failure. in an automotive application, they will typically only last about a year, unfortunately.
